Description:
Hatikvah (The Hope) is a 19th-century Jewish poem and modern-day national anthem of Israel. In this romantic-style arrangement, Ben Andrew shares the melody between both the violin and piano. Through the use of subtle dissonance and a rich harmonic texture, the music conveys a sense of struggle, despair and sadness, as well as the eternal hope expressed in the original poem upon which the music is based.
Perform this piece in your ABRSM Violin Grade 8, or Trinity College London Violin Grade 7 exams.
